Islamabad: Pakistan has emerged as one of the most dangerous countries in the world for journalists, with attacks on media workers reaching alarming levels, a report highlighted on Saturday.
It mentioned that the harassment of journalists in Pakistan has been a longstanding issue, but has intensified sharply over the past three years.
According to a report in Athens-based Geopolitico, since Asim Munir took over as the Pakistani Army Chief in late 2022, his hardline religious stance has emboldened the establishment to suppress dissent with unprecedented force.
